/**
* Detects incrementer jumbling in for loops.
*
* This rule is based on the PMD rule catalog. The jumbling incrementer sniff
* detects the usage of one and the same incrementer into an outer and an inner
* loop. Even it is intended this is confusing code.
*
* <code>
* class Foo
* {
* public function bar($x)
* {
* for ($i = 0; $i < 10; $i++)
* {
* for ($k = 0; $k < 20; $i++)
* {
* echo 'Hello';
* }
* }
* }
* }
* </code>
*
* @category PHP
* @package PHP_CodeSniffer
* @author Manuel Pichler <mapi@manuel-pichler.de>
* @copyright 2007-2008 Manuel Pichler. All rights reserved.
* @license http://www.opensource.org/licenses/bsd-license.php BSD License
* @version Release: 1.3.3
* @link http://pear.php.net/package/PHP_CodeSniffer
*/
class Generic_Sniffs_CodeAnalysis_JumbledIncrementerSniff implements PHP_CodeSniffer_Sniff
{
/**
* Registers the tokens that this sniff wants to listen for.
*
* @return array(integer)
*/
public function register()
{
return array(T_FOR);
}//end register()
/**
* Processes this test, when one of its tokens is encountered.
*
* @param PHP_CodeSniffer_File $phpcsFile The file being scanned.
* @param int $stackPtr The position of the current token
* in the stack passed in $tokens.
*
* @return void
*/
public function process(PHP_CodeSniffer_File $phpcsFile, $stackPtr)
{
$tokens = $phpcsFile->getTokens();
$token = $tokens[$stackPtr];
// Skip for-loop without body.
if (isset($token['scope_opener']) === false) {
return;
}
// Find incrementors for outer loop.
$outer = $this->findIncrementers($tokens, $token);
// Skip if empty.
if (count($outer) === 0) {
return;
}
// Find nested for loops.
$start = ++$token['scope_opener'];
$end = --$token['scope_closer'];
for (; $start <= $end; ++$start) {
if ($tokens[$start]['code'] !== T_FOR) {
continue;
}
$inner = $this->findIncrementers($tokens, $tokens[$start]);
$diff = array_intersect($outer, $inner);
if (count($diff) !== 0) {
$error = 'Loop incrementor (%s) jumbling with inner loop';
$data = array(join(', ', $diff));
$phpcsFile->addWarning($error, $stackPtr, 'Found', $data);
}
}
}//end process()
/**
* Get all used variables in the incrementer part of a for statement.
*
* @param array(integer=>array) $tokens Array with all code sniffer tokens.
* @param array(string=>mixed) $token Current for loop token
*
* @return array(string) List of all found incrementer variables.
*/
protected function findIncrementers(array $tokens, array $token)
{
// Skip invalid statement.
if (isset($token['parenthesis_opener']) === false) {
return array();
}
$start = ++$token['parenthesis_opener'];
$end = --$token['parenthesis_closer'];
$incrementers = array();
$semicolons = 0;
for ($next = $start; $next <= $end; ++$next) {
$code = $tokens[$next]['code'];
if ($code === T_SEMICOLON) {
++$semicolons;
} else if ($semicolons === 2 && $code === T_VARIABLE) {
$incrementers[] = $tokens[$next]['content'];
}
}
return $incrementers;
}//end findIncrementers()
}//end class
?>

<?php
/**
* Checks the cyclomatic complexity (McCabe) for functions.
*
* PHP version 5
*
* @category PHP
* @package PHP_CodeSniffer
* @author Greg Sherwood <gsherwood@squiz.net>
* @author Marc McIntyre <mmcintyre@squiz.net>
* @copyright 2006-2011 Squiz Pty Ltd (ABN 77 084 670 600)
* @license http://matrix.squiz.net/developer/tools/php_cs/licence BSD Licence
* @link http://pear.php.net/package/PHP_CodeSniffer
*/
/**
* Checks the cyclomatic complexity (McCabe) for functions.
*
* The cyclomatic complexity (also called McCabe code metrics)
* indicates the complexity within a function by counting
* the different paths the function includes.
*
* @category PHP
* @package PHP_CodeSniffer
* @author Johann-Peter Hartmann <hartmann@mayflower.de>
* @author Greg Sherwood <gsherwood@squiz.net>
* @copyright 2007 Mayflower GmbH
* @license http://matrix.squiz.net/developer/tools/php_cs/licence BSD Licence
* @version Release: 1.3.3
* @link http://pear.php.net/package/PHP_CodeSniffer
*/
class Generic_Sniffs_Metrics_CyclomaticComplexitySniff implements PHP_CodeSniffer_Sniff
{
/**
* A complexity higher than this value will throw a warning.
*
* @var int
*/
public $complexity = 10;
/**
* A complexity higer than this value will throw an error.
*
* @var int
*/
public $absoluteComplexity = 20;
/**
* Returns an array of tokens this test wants to listen for.
*
* @return array
*/
public function register()
{
return array(T_FUNCTION);
}//end register()
/**
* Processes this test, when one of its tokens is encountered.
*
* @param PHP_CodeSniffer_File $phpcsFile The file being scanned.
* @param int $stackPtr The position of the current token
* in the stack passed in $tokens.
*
* @return void
*/
public function process(PHP_CodeSniffer_File $phpcsFile, $stackPtr)
{
$this->currentFile = $phpcsFile;
$tokens = $phpcsFile->getTokens();
// Ignore abstract methods.
if (isset($tokens[$stackPtr]['scope_opener']) === false) {
return;
}
// Detect start and end of this function definition.
$start = $tokens[$stackPtr]['scope_opener'];
$end = $tokens[$stackPtr]['scope_closer'];
// Predicate nodes for PHP.
$find = array(
'T_CASE',
'T_DEFAULT',
'T_CATCH',
'T_IF',
'T_FOR',
'T_FOREACH',
'T_WHILE',
'T_DO',
'T_ELSEIF',
);
$complexity = 1;
// Iterate from start to end and count predicate nodes.
for ($i = ($start + 1); $i < $end; $i++) {
if (in_array($tokens[$i]['type'], $find) === true) {
$complexity++;
}
}
if ($complexity > $this->absoluteComplexity) {
$error = 'Function\'s cyclomatic complexity (%s) exceeds allowed maximum of %s';
$data = array(
$complexity,
$this->absoluteComplexity,
);
$phpcsFile->addError($error, $stackPtr, 'MaxExceeded', $data);
} else if ($complexity > $this->complexity) {
$warning = 'Function\'s cyclomatic complexity (%s) exceeds %s; consider refactoring the function';
$data = array(
$complexity,
$this->complexity,
);
$phpcsFile->addWarning($warning, $stackPtr, 'TooHigh', $data);
}
return;
}//end process()
}//end class
?>
